Job Description:

Sr. Regulatory Professional  Labelling 

The Sr. Regulatory Professional  Labelling is responsible for managing the creation, review, quality-control and maintenance of product labeling and associated artwork throughout the product lifecycle. This role coordinates cross-functionally to ensure timely, compliant, and highquality labeling deliverables for submissions, approvals, and postapproval changes. 

Key responsibilities 

  • Product Insert, Package Label and Artwork QC review and documentation. 

  • Labeling E2E activity tracking system maintenance. 

  • Maintain labelling compliance following company policies and procedures. 

  • Implement local labelling E2E process to comply with local regulations and global standards. 

  • Collaborate with cross functions including XJP CQ, R&D QM, AP, global labelling CoE, and local/global cross-functions to ensure labeling process implementation and compliance. 

  • Participate in labeling strategy and kickoff activities for new product/indication; support China Regulatory Labeling (RL) to develop, drive and maintain the labeling activity plan. 

  • Prepare and maintain draft China labeling document based on global reference documents in collaboration with RL and cross-functional teams. Support RL to coordinate cross-functional review, QC review and sign-off following SOP and WI. 

  • Draft Local Labelling Deviation Form, manage LLD tracking and handovers. 

  • Support RL for health authority (HA) interactions: responses to HA labeling comments, implement agreed changes, and update labeling files accordingly. 

  • Contribute to continuous improvement of labeling processes, templates, checklists and training materials. 
  • Perform related duties as assigned by supervisor. 

Requirement 

  • Bachelor’s degree in Life Sciences, Pharmacy, Regulatory Affairs, or related field (or equivalent experience). A master degree or above is preferable. 

  • 2–5 years’ experience in pharm (experiences in regulatory is preferred). 

  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ills in English; Strong attention to detail and accuracy in text and formatting. 

  • Analytical mindset and problemsolving skills; ability to interpret regulatory feedback and translate into clear labeling actions. 

  • Proven project coordination and timemanagement skills; ability to manage multiple labeling activities and deadlines. 

  • Ability to work crossfunctionally and influence without direct authority. 

  • Proficiency with MS Office (Word, Excel, PowerPoint); experience with labeling management tools is a plus.
